Supercharge Your Innovation With Domain-Expert AI Agents!

Highly reliable cross-session web application instrumentation

A technology for testing items and users, applied in special data processing applications, instruments, computers, etc., can solve problems such as providing good user experience, losing user tracking data, and unreliable content

Inactive Publication Date: 2013-04-10
APOLLO GROUP
View PDF5 Cites 2 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Unfortunately, sending client-side content to the server-side in response to a page unload is not reliable, nor does it provide a good user experience when possible
Also, since the current solution keeps user tracking data in volatile memory, failure to transfer client-side queued data could result in permanent loss of valuable user tracking data after ending a session

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Highly reliable cross-session web application instrumentation
  • Highly reliable cross-session web application instrumentation
  • Highly reliable cross-session web application instrumentation

Examples

Experimental program
Comparison scheme
Effect test

specific Embodiment approach

[0014] In the following description, for purposes of explanation, numerous specific details are set forth in order to provide a thorough understanding of the present invention. It will be apparent, however, that the invention may be practiced without these specific details. In other instances, well-known structures and devices are shown in block diagram form in order to avoid unnecessarily obscuring the invention.

[0015] review

[0016] A reliable caching mechanism is provided for client-side caching of data capturing user interactions with a remote service, where the user interacts with the remote service through a computing device. According to one embodiment, such data (referred to herein as "test items") is cached in a client-side offline queue. Within the client-side queue, collected test items persist between user sessions with the remote service. Since the client side does not lose the test items collected in the session at the end of the session, there is no need 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A reliable caching mechanism is provided for client-side caching of data that captures user interaction with a remote service, where users interact with the remote service through a computing device. Such instrumentation items are cached in a client-side offline queue. Within the client-side queue, the gathered instrumentation items survive between user sessions with the remote service. Because the client-side does not lose the instrumentation items that were gathered in a session when the session ends, those instrumentation items do not all need to be transferred to the server-side at or prior to the termination of the session in which the instrumentation items are collected. Instead, the instrumentation items may be sent to the server-side at times that will have less impact on the user experience, (such as when the computing device is otherwise idle).

Description

technical field [0001] The present invention relates to managing the collection of user tracking data representing user interactions with web content at client devices. More specifically, the present invention relates to caching user tracking data locally at a client device and selectively transmitting the cached data. Background technique [0002] Increasingly, people are getting services of one form or another over the Internet. For example, a user of a client device may obtain news, television, weather information, and even college education from a remotely located computer device over a network. Such client devices may take many forms including, but not limited to, cellular telephones, personal digital assistants, laptop computers, and desktop computers. [0003] Knowing how users interact with such remotely provided services is useful for a number of reasons. For example, a service provider may find it useful to know that users frequently hover their input focus (suc...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06F15/167
CPCG06F16/9574
Inventor T·J·布林尼卡
Owner APOLLO GROUP
Features
  • R&D
  • Intellectual Property
  • Life Sciences
  • Materials
  • Tech Scout
Why Patsnap Eureka
  • Unparalleled Data Quality
  • Higher Quality Content
  • 60% Fewer Hallucinations
Social media
Patsnap Eureka Blog
Learn More